We was looking for somewhere to eat crabs and I seen where they had all you could eat. We are hard core crab people so we know great crabs. I was nervous at 1st being it was an oriental type restaurant, but they did a superb job. They were very flavorful and easy to get into. The potatoes and corn was also very good. Of course the price is high but that is to be expected crabs are basically a delicacy these days. We went around 2 on Saturday afternoon and there was no wait at all. The server was super nice and attended to our every need. We will be going back. I give them 5 stars.

Initially we went for The Stadium, but seeing as no one was working…. We went next door to Pho Boy. This place is a great concept and I can see how it COULD be a decent place to eat but that was not the case. Let’s start with the Food. Food: The food surprisingly was not bad. I ordered the Beef Hibatchi and it was Good! The Beef was tender and the veggies were crisp. If I this review was just about the starts, they would get 5! Service: AWFUL, AWFUL, AWFUL. We waited 45 minutes before we could even get our order in because we could find no one to talk speak with, no host, not waitress, no bartender… Once we finally were able to order, the “Bartender” looked directly at the couple next to us and told them she didn’t know how to make any drinks and the best she could do was a beer or a shot. They ordered a shot of Patron and she stated that they Ran out. You Ran out of Patron at a Casino? Anyway… would 10/10 Not Recommend this restaurant.
